Oxford and OpenAI have launched a collaboration to advance research and education, building on the University of Oxford's participation in NextGenAI, a consortium with OpenAI and 15 leading research institutions. This partnership aims to accelerate research breakthroughs and transform education using AI.
The five-year collaboration will provide students and faculty staff with access to research grant funding, enterprise-level security, and cutting-edge AI tools, enhancing teaching, learning, and research. The initiative is an expansion of Oxford's investment in AI capabilities, with the university rolling out ChatGPT Edu to 3,000 academics and staff.
